Baby Woodrose is releasing a new album called "Dropout!" on September 20, but it's not a proper full-length. Rather, it's a tribute to the garage=rock groups of the 60s that have influenced the band over the years. Four of the tracks were recording during the sessions for the last album "Money For Soul" and the rest of the lot were done when the project idea was finalized. Tracklist:
01. Can’t Explain (Love)
02. I Lost You In My Mind (The Painted Faces)
03. Who’s It Gonna Be (The Lollipop Shoppe)
04. I Don’t Ever Wanna Come Down (The 13th Floor Elevators)
05. The World Ain’t Round, It’s Square (The Savages)
06. Dropout Boogie (Captain Beefheart and his Magic Band)
07. I’m Going Home (The Sonics)
08. This Perfect Day (The Saints)
09. Not Right (The Stooges)
10. A Child Of A Few Hours (The West Coast Pop Art Experimental Band)
The first single will be for the song "Can't explain".

Danish thrash band Mnemic has announced that their upcoming album "The Audio Injected Soul" will be the first music CD recorded using Binaural Techniques which approximates full three-dimensional sound. So far I guess the technology has been only used in video game development, but you can read more about it here: https://www.am3d.com/inside/index.htm
UK-based label Mate Recordings' next release will be a special double a-side 7" featuring "Worse than a girl" from Helsinki disco queens Boys of Scandinavia and a Paul Haig remix of "Back in fashion" by Finnish electro act Roger. It'll be limited edition of course and should be available sometime around October.
Amon Amarth's new album "Fate of Norns" will be issued as a limited-edition digipack with a bonus live DVD called "Amon Amarth live at Grand Rokk" that was recorded at a show in Reykjavik, Iceland on March 5, 2004. Look for it September 6 from Metal Blade Records. Download the track "An ancient sign of coming storm": https://www.metalblade.com/bands/Amon_Amarth/aa-aasocs.mp3
